Lot No. 81


Rembrandt Harmensz van Rijn


(Leiden 1606-1669 Amsterdam)
The Return of the Prodigal Son, 1636, etching on laid paper, signed and dated Rembrandt f in the plate 1636, 15,6 x 13,8 cm, with narrow margins along platemarks, Bartsch 91, White-Boon 91, New Hollstein 159 III (of III), mounted, unframed, (Sch)

Provenance:
Collection Princes D'Arenberg, Brussels and Nord-Kirchen, Lugt 567;
Private collection, Germany
